Understanding human anatomy is crucial for accurate body drawing. Head is one-seventh, torso two-sevenths, arms and legs three-sevenths of height. Male and female bodies have different proportions and muscle structures

Females have wider hips due to birth anatomy and estrogen. Four basic body shapes exist: hourglass, rectangular, inverted triangle, triangle. Fat distribution affects silhouette: low, medium, high, apple, pear shapes. Natural body shape variations exist: shorter, longer torso, dwarfism
